| Aspect | Survey Crew Member | Survey Technician |
|---|
| Credentials | High school diploma or equivalent; basic knowledge of surveying tools | Same as Crew Member; may require additional certifications |
| Work Environment | Outdoor, on-site at construction or land development projects | Similar; often involves more technical tasks and data collection |
| Job Responsibilities | Assisting with field measurements, setting up equipment, supporting survey team | Operating survey instruments, collecting data, ensuring accuracy |
| Industry Usage | Common entry-level role in surveying firms and construction projects | More technical, often requiring experience or specialized training |
Survey Crew Members and Survey Technicians work closely in the field, with Crew Members supporting the technical tasks performed by Technicians. While both roles require outdoor work and basic surveying knowledge, Technicians typically handle more complex data collection and equipment operation. The roles are interconnected, with Crew Members often gaining experience to advance into Technician positions.
